Right to Care Zambia (RTCZ) has provided public health service delivery and technical assistance in partnership with the Ministry of Health since 2016. Its work includes HIV/AIDS, maternal and child health, epidemic response, malaria and TB, public health research, social behaviour change, laboratory services, pharmaceutical supply chains and non-communicable diseases. Position: Systems Support Manager Number of vacancies: 1 Contract type: Fixed Term. Contract duration: TBA. Location: Lusaka, Zambia Reporting to: Head of IT Date advertised: 10 September 2026.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E • Bachelor’s degree from an accredited tertiary institution in a technology-related field. • IT certifications (Microsoft, CISCO). • Five years’ relevant IT infrastructure, network support and operations-management experience, with a technology background and understanding of service management, networks and internet connectivity. • High proficiency in Microsoft Office and other software tools. DESIRABLE Q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E • Postgraduate qualification in a technology-related field. • Seven years’ IT infrastructure, connectivity/network support and operations-management experience, including eLMIS or other health-information/supply-chain systems across multiple sites, with understanding of service management and infrastructure. COMPETENCIES Selection, assignment and development of subordinates; leadership and delegation of responsibility/authority; planning, execution and communication. KEY PERFORMANCE AREAS IT infrastructure management • Determine network, server, storage, hardware and connectivity needs for eLMIS and related systems across RTCZ and supported MoH/ZAMMSA sites. • Manage platform operations and stability/uptime of medium-to-large infrastructure. • Define hardware, software and connectivity requirements and financial inputs. • Set infrastructure strategy/architecture aligned with business strategy and service quality. • Lead central/provincial infrastructure project implementations. Network and connectivity • Manage LAN, WAN and internet supporting eLMIS at central, provincial and facility levels. • Ensure reliable, secure and cost-effective connectivity with providers/vendors. • Monitor performance, resolve availability issues and plan upgrades/redundancy. eLMIS availability and support • Direct secure continuous operations, administration and maintenance. • Meet/exceed service levels and infrastructure/connectivity KPIs. • Oversee first-line response, escalation and incident quality control. • Coordinate hardware repairs, remote support via TeamViewer/AnyDesk, and courier/repair arrangements for faulty facility equipment. Security, backup and continuity • Establish security, privacy, disaster-recovery and continuity measures. • Execute security programmes covering policy, access, privacy, vendors and auditing. • Ensure backups, recovery tests and secure processing to protect eLMIS data and electronic health records. Team supervision and administration • Lead/develop provincial Systems Administrators and oversee deliverables/performance. • Provide skills transfer and in-house staff training. • Lead infrastructure/connectivity policy and procedure development. • Monitor/control budgets and ensure daily, weekly and monthly statistics/status reports meet departmental needs. Vendor, change and records management • Lead discussions with engineers, contractors, providers and vendors; manage service contracts. • Liaise with governance structures on infrastructure, connectivity and records control. • Document/test changes before production deployment and manage/document later changes.
